AT&T offering free calls, texts to Mexico after quake
AT&T is offering free calls and text messages to Mexico following the devastating earthquake.

If you're worried about staying in touch with your loved ones impacted by the devastating earthquake in central Mexico, AT&T is waiving charges for calls and text messages from customers in the US to Mexico.

The waiver, which is in effect until Sept. 21, covers AT&T wireless, prepaid and landline customers. The carrier will issue credits for charges imposed since Sept. 19.

For those in Mexico, AT&T is offering free data, calls and text messages until Sept. 21.

AT&T says its network is performing normally following the quake, but it recommends text messages over calls due to the possibility of network congestion.
